Learners Guide to Metal Polishing - More often than not, metal finishing is required for aesthetics and for clean-room uses. It really is one of the more favored methods simply because of its use in intensifying the natural attractiveness of the item, for instance, vehicle parts, kitchenware or motorbike parts. Additionally, a large number of clean-rooms must have a lustrous finish to lower the porosity of the metal surfaces that can cause particles to gather and contaminate. An instance of this practice would be in a vacuum chamber.

You will discover a lot of means to finish metal, and we can take a look at several of the methods involved. Metals can be finished electromechanically, chemically, manually by hand, or with purpose made buffing machines. A special polishing compound or paste is regularly utilized, that might include dolomite, limestone, tripoli,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, chalk,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its poor thermal conductivity, rather high viscidness, and hardness is considered the most time-consuming. Alternatively, products created from non-ferrous metal will be more responsive to polishing, because they require the minimum amount of operations.

Finishing buffs plastered with compound will be markedly impacted by specific pressure on the polishing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face can be accelerated to a precise range, although further surpassing the optimal amount of force not only reduces the quality of the procedure, but in addition degrades performance, might cause wear on the product, and also an evident heating of the work-pieces, an outcome of friction. When working thinner metal, it is greater temperature (and the corresponding bendability of the metal) that can cause parts to flex, buckle or twist. Usually, it will take a specialized polisher to think about each one of these things to both prevent damage to the part and to perform the job successfully. In order to radically enhance the quality of the completed surface, the polishing operation really should be done with reduced vigour and not as much pressure so that you might subsequently produce a surface with no scratches or fine lines due to the the buffing process, thus ar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
